### Item 14 — Markdown Pipeline Sanitization

Verify the Quillgate rendering pipeline strips raw HTML before the Fennwick parser stage, not after. Confirm allowlist covers image and link schemes only. Check that embedded footnote syntax cannot escape the sandbox container. Inspect regression tests added after the Dortmere incident. Findings should be escalated directly to the pipeline owner named below.

account owner for bawip-tahag: Raleth Quenok

Hey team — handing off the GarageSense occupancy feed before I roll off the Lotwise project. It polls the sensor gateway every 30 seconds and pushes counts to the display boards at the Fernmont deck. If the feed stalls, restart the collector first; that fixes 90% of issues. Should the vault account get locked during a restart, you'll need to recover it. The passphrase is below.

unlock words, kajef-kadug: sorys-pelax-lamael-tamvan-briiel-novdor-fenwyn-tamdor-oliion-keleth-julok-belion-ralok

The Orvane Labs bike cage and the east and west parking gates operate on separate access schedules, and facilities desk staff should note that visitor vehicles may only use the west gate between 07:00 and 19:00. Cyclists requesting cage access must show a valid day pass, and their details should be entered in the access ledger before the cage is opened. Gates must never be propped open, even briefly, during deliveries. When a manual override is required at either gate, use the code below.

staff pass of fadup-fawig = bdg-FUNKS-4

## Environments — Fernstile UI Snapshot Service

Welcome aboard. Snapshot testing of our UI components runs in three environments: local, staging, and the golden-image runner. Snapshots are only considered authoritative when generated on the golden-image runner, since font rendering differs across machines — never commit snapshots produced locally. Staging mirrors the runner closely and is fine for smoke checks. Each environment pulls its renderer version and baseline paths from its own config; the staging environment uses the following.

config for haweg-bagag:
[kasath]
host = kasath.qirvancorp.internal
user = kasath_svc
database = kasath_prod